1. Trang chủ
  2. » Công Nghệ Thông Tin

Beginning Database Design- P1 potx

20 324 0

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Định dạng
Số trang 20
Dung lượng 424,14 KB

Nội dung

[...]... Relational Database Modeling 1 Chapter 1: Database Modeling Past and Present 3 Grasping the Concept of a Database Understanding a Database Model What Is an Application? The Evolution of Database Modeling File Systems Hierarchical Database Model Network Database Model Relational Database Model Relational Database Management System The History of the Relational Database Model 4 5 5 6 7 8 8 9 11 11 Object Database. .. Relational Database Model 4 5 5 6 7 8 8 9 11 11 Object Database Model Object-Relational Database Model 12 14 Examining the Types of Databases 14 Transactional Databases Decision Support Databases Hybrid Databases Understanding Database Model Design Defining the Objectives Looking at Methods of Database Design Summary Chapter 2: Database Modeling in the Workplace Understanding Business Rules and Objectives What... Hardware Architectures RAID Arrays Standby Databases Replication Grids and Computer Clustering Summary 396 397 397 399 400 401 Glossary 403 Appendix A: Exercise Answers 421 Appendix B: Sample Databases 435 Index xvi 443 Introduction This book focuses on the relational database model from a beginning perspective The title is, therefore, Beginning Database Design A database is a repository for data In other... 174 175 176 178 182 183 183 184 190 191 192 Contents Chapter 8: Building Fast-Performing Database Models The Needs of Different Database Models Factors Affecting OLTP Database Model Tuning Factors Affecting Client-Server Database Model Tuning Factors Affecting Data Warehouse Database Model Tuning Understanding Database Model Tuning Writing Efficient Queries 193 194 194 195 196 197 198 The SELECT Command... a Database Model Table and Relation Level Business Rules Individual Field Business Rules Field Level Business Rules for the OLTP Database Model Field Level Business Rules for the Data warehouse Database Model 355 356 357 358 360 362 363 364 364 364 364 364 364 370 xv Contents Encoding Business Rules Encoding Business Rules for the OLTP Database Model Encoding Business Rules for the Data Warehouse Database. .. store lots of information in a database A relational database is a special type of database using structures called tables Tables are linked together using what are called relationships You can build tables with relationships between those tables, not only to organize your data, but also to allow later retrieval of information from the database The process of relational database model design is the method... Study: Creating Tables The OLTP Database Model The Data Warehouse Database Model Case Study: Enforcing Table Relationships Referential Integrity Primary and Foreign Keys Using Surrogate Keys Identifying versus Non-Identifying Relationships Parent Records without Children Child Records with Optional Parents The OLTP Database Model with Referential Integrity The Data Warehouse Database Model with Referential... Detailed Design 319 Case Study: Refining Field Structure 320 The OLTP Database Model The Data Warehouse Database Model 320 323 Understanding Datatypes Simple Datatypes ANSI (American National Standards Institute) Datatypes Microsoft Access Datatypes Specialized Datatypes Case Study: Defining Datatypes The OLTP Database Model The Data Warehouse Database Model 329 329 330 331 331 332 332 336 Understanding Keys... Indexing 339 342 342 343 The OLTP Database Model The Data Warehouse Database Model Summary Exercises 343 345 352 352 Chapter 12: Business Rules and Field Settings 353 What Are Business Rules Again? Classifying Business Rules in a Database Model 354 355 Normalization, Normal Forms, and Relations Classifying Relationship Types Explicitly Declared Field Settings Storing Code in the Database Stored Procedure Stored... Different Databases The Basics of SQL 103 104 104 104 107 108 111 116 121 122 122 123 124 125 125 126 Querying a Database Using SELECT 127 Basic Queries Filtering with the WHERE Clause Precedence Sorting with the ORDER BY Clause 127 130 132 134 xi Contents Aggregating with the GROUP BY Clause Join Queries Nested Queries Composite Queries Changing Data in a Database Understanding Transactions Changing Database . 7 Hierarchical Database Model 8 Network Database Model 8 Relational Database Model 9 Relational Database Management System 11 The History of the Relational Database Model 11 Object Database Model. Model 12 Object-Relational Database Model 14 Examining the Types of Databases 14 Transactional Databases 15 Decision Support Databases 15 Hybrid Databases 16 Understanding Database Model Design 16 Defining. Relational Database Modeling 1 Chapter 1: Database Modeling Past and Present 3 Grasping the Concept of a Database 4 Understanding a Database Model 5 What Is an Application? 5 The Evolution of Database

Ngày đăng: 03/07/2014, 01:20

TỪ KHÓA LIÊN QUAN